U.S. Luxury Equestrian Tack and Apparel Market

ECGI notes that further product development for Pacific Saddlery will help expand the emerging brand’s offerings, capturing a significant share of the U.S. luxury equestrian tack and apparel market, a market that is uniquely profitable and consistent, with fewer pressures to “go public”. Valued at $300 million annually, the market is expected to experience steady growth at an annual growth rate of about 4-6%. This growth is expected to be driven by increasing interest in equestrian sports and leisure activities among affluent consumers, as well as innovations in product design. The strategic move also positions ECGI Holdings alongside key leaders in the equestrian market, including Hermès, Charles Ancona, and CWD Sellier.

The luxury equestrian market is segmented into two:

  • The equestrian apparel segment, which comprises high-end riding gear, including breeches, jackets, boots, and helmets
  • The tack and equipment segment, which includes premium saddles, bridles, and other tack, often custom-made or from renowned brands

With promises of affluence, prestige, customization, and quality, the market has spurred interest among the wealthy, affluent, and equestrian sports enthusiasts. Accordingly, major brands like Hermès, Charles Ancona, Pikeur, Animo, and Cavalleria Toscana, which focus on the apparel segment, and CWD Sellier, Hermès, Stubben, and Devoucoux, which target the tack and equipment segment, increasingly compete to deliver on these promises and, as a result, enjoy the attractive revenues and margins the industry has to offer.

Attractive Gross and Profit Margins

On average, apparel like high-end riding jackets, breeches, and boots can cost anywhere between $200 to more than $1,000 per item, while premium saddles and bridles range from $1,500 to over $10,000, depending on the level of customization and brand prestige. Usually, the premium pricing of apparel, tack, and equipment translates to high gross margins and net profit margins. For instance, luxury equestrian brands often enjoy high gross margins of 50-70%, with net profit margins varying between 10-20%.

What makes the luxury equestrian market attractive to the likes of ECGI, Pacific Saddlery, and other players is that these net profit margins are often higher than the retail market’s average. The profit margins translate to higher profitability for equestrian companies, ensuring a continuous flow of working capital. According to observers, this explains why there are no public equestrian companies – such companies are usually so profitable that they consistently have enough working capital to remain private.

As an additional testament to the veracity of this observation, Dover Saddlery, Inc., a leading specialty retailer and the largest omnichannel market of equestrian products in the U.S. at that time, was taken private in 2015. Until its delisting, the company was traded on the Nasdaq Stock Market (https://nnw.fm/igd7t).
